HARVEST CHICKEN SALAD



Harvest Chicken Salad image

Apples and tangy orange dressing makes this chicken salad the main attraction. Cook's tip: A 2-pound rotisserie-cooked chicken can be used to prepare this recipe, if desired. You may also want to top this with "Recipe #220615".

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 oranges
1/3 cup fat-free mayonnaise
2 tablespoons stone ground mustard
2 tablespoons s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 small garlic clove, pressed
1 (6 ounce) package fresh baby spinach leaves
2 cups diced roasted chicken meat
1 cup celery rib, diced
2 medium Red Delicious apples
1/2 cup red onion, chopped
3/4 cup dried sweetened cranberries
1/2 cup pecan halves, toasted (optional)
orange section (optional)

Steps:

  • For dressing, zest one orange to measure 2 teaspoons zest.
  • Juice oranges to measure 1/2 cup juice.
  • Combine orange zest, mayonnaise, mustard, sugar, salt, black pepper and pressed garlic; whisk until smooth.
  • While continuously whisking, add orange juice in a thin, steady stream; set dressing aside.
  • For salad, place spinach in bottom of large serving bowl.
  • Dice chicken and celery.
  • Cut apples in half lengthwise; remove stems and seeds.
  • Cut each apple half into small pieces.
  • Chop onion.
  • Layer chicken, celery, apples, onion, cranberries and pecans, if desired, over spinach.
  • To serve, drizzle dressing over salad and toss to coat.
  • Top with orange segments (if you want to add this, you will need at least 1 extra orange) and Whole-Grain Croutons, if desired.
  • Serve immediately.

SUMMER HARVEST CHICKEN-POTATO SALAD



Summer Harvest Chicken-Potato Salad image

Betty Crocker's Heart Healthy Cookbook shares a recipe! Enjoy this hearty chicken-potato salad that's ready in just 30 minutes - perfect for a dinner.

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 medium red potatoes (1 lb), cut into 3/4-inch cubes
1/2 lb fresh green beans, trimmed, cut into 1-inch pieces (about 2 cups)
1/2 cup plain fat-free yogurt
1/3 cup fat-free ranch dressing
1 tablespoon prepared horseradish
1/4 teaspoon salt
Dash pepper
2 cups cut-up cooked chicken breast
2/3 cup thinly sliced celery
Torn salad greens, if desired

Steps:

  • In 2-quart saucepan, heat 6 cups lightly salted water to boiling. Add potatoes; return to boiling. Reduce heat; simmer 5 minutes. Add green beans; cook uncovered 8 to 12 minutes longer or until potatoes and beans are crisp-tender.
  • Meanwhile, in small bowl, mix yogurt, dressing, horseradish, salt and pepper; set aside.
  • Drain potatoes and green beans; rinse with cold water to cool. In large serving bowl, mix potatoes, green beans, chicken and celery. Pour yogurt mixture over salad; toss gently to coat. Line plates with greens; spoon salad onto greens.
